Insulated glass

Insulated glass windows are an effective way to lower your energy costs. These glass units are designed to cool your home in the summer and heating it during the winter. They help reduce the amount of noise pollution.

Insulated windows are constructed from two or more panes of glass separated by the spacer. The spacer is filled with gas or air to fill in the gap between the panes. A third or fourth layer of glass can improve the insulation of the unit.

Egress window glass

Glass-Replacement-150x150.jpgEgress windows are the ideal way to increase the airflow in your basement. They can also be useful in the case of the possibility of a fire. However, they have to be installed and sized correctly.

Local building codes are the most effective method to determine if your basement needs Egress windows. These guidelines will outline the specific requirements. For example there are rules on the square feet and the minimum height and the minimum width. In general, the egress window has to be at least 24 inches high and 20 inches wide in order to be compliant with the code.

There are numerous types of Egress windows. The most popular type is the casement egress windows. The type of window is able to open and close like a door. It swings out to one side or other to create a clear escape route in case of emergency.

Another kind of Egress windows is the awning. They have a hinge at the top that allows air circulation. In addition to the standard awning window you can get an "power vent" to greatly increase the circulation.
